Yes, Alex Notman received a career ending injury when his foot was on the wrong end of a Venus free kick. to add insult to injury, Notman had broken early from the wall in an attempt to block the free kick so he received a yellow card while on a stretcher. If you take away the Norwich connection, rather sad that a 23 year old had his career ended by a freak accident. |  |

Cundy or De Vos on 06:09 - Jul 26 with 2409 views | IPS_wich | JDV's turning circle was slower than Burgess was 12 months ago; so with the game having gone more down the pace route then it would have to be Cundy. But JDV was one in a long line of tall centre backs we've had who were imperious in the air (Beattie, Butcher, Linighan, Mowbray, JDV). Please don't think I'm suggesting that Linighan and De Vos were anywhere near the players of the other three in any aspect other than in the air. One of the things that I think Richard Naylor never got enough credit for was how quick he was. In many ways he was the perfect CB partner for De Vos and helped compensate for JDV's deficiencies. |  | |  |
